Job Description: Assistant Director in Financial Due Diligence will be instrumental in driving the success of our transactions. You will lead complex due diligence projects, manage high-performing teams, and serve as a trusted advisor to our clients during mergers and acquisitions. Your expertise will help clients navigate through the intricacies of transactions, ensuring they make informed and strategic decisions.
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ee financial due diligence engagements, ensuring the delivery of high-quality analysis and reporting.
- Lead and mentor teams, setting objectives and guiding professional development.
- Develop and maintain strong relationships with clients, understanding their needs and providing tailored advice.
- Collaborate with other service lines to deliver integrated transaction advisory services.
- Drive business development by identifying new opportunities and enhancing firms market presence.
- Contribute thought leadership and insights on market trends and best practices in financial due diligence.
- A professional accounting / finance qualification (CA, CPA, ACCA, MBA or equivalent)
- At least 10-12 years of experience in financial due diligence, with a proven track record in a leadership role.
- Exceptional analytical and project management skills.
- Strong business acumen with the ability to interpret complex financial information.
- Excellent communication and presentation skills.
